My husband and I bought a conversion van in 1997. There was a problem with the brakes right away. The dealership kept telling us that there was no problem (a few times). I ended up hitting a deer, my garage door and almost hitting a wall of a local business. We took it to the dealership and was told again that there was nothing wrong. Mind you, this all happened while it was under warrenty, except the garage door. The dealership refused to back up their product, after the warrenty was off, saying that we did not bring it in. I have the invoices to say that we did. Needless to say, we ended up paying $1200 to fix the brakes. The computer that runs the anti-locks, was faulty. The anti-locks weren't working either.

My other car is a mustang that came with an alarm system already installed. The alarm keeps discharging the battery. This is a 2004. This should not be happening. The car is only driven in the summer months. The convertible top keeps binding also. The dealership won't fix either problem. The car is still under warrenty. They are saying that the alarm is not included in the sale of the car. I drove it off the showroom floor with this alarm already installed. It came with the car. It should be covered with the warrenty. We didn't ask for this alarm. It was a good selling point.

The top to the covertible sometimes binds. There are wear marks on the vinyl. The dealership won't even touch this, as it doesn't act up when they have it in their shop. You can see where the top is getting pinched.

I worked in the "industry" for several years at one of the dealers just down the road from Tousley (the one with the big red planet that is going out of business...got laid off from them last summer..) anyway I know all about the woes of trying to get your vehicle serviced if the problem is "obscure" in any way. I had a similar issue with another metro Ford dealer's service department. Being an auto mechanic and owning a vehicle that is still under factory warranty I thought I had an advantage in being able to describe and pinpoint the issues better than average people, but I was wrong. Basically the same run-around you got, and the problem never got fixed. I contacted the service department, and the manager, and after continuing to get shoved around even contacted Ford Customer Care and had several conversations with them over the phone and by email. Long story short I never got anything fixed, they never found any problems, and Ford wanted nothing to do with helping me when I was in or out of factory warranty.
My suggestion would be to contact as many people related to, or not related to, the Tousley Ford service department, and if nothing gets accomplished that way, then contact Ford Customer Care. If you have a way to "prove" that there was an issue that was brought up by you and not addressed or fixed (such as receipts or work orders from when there was "no problem found" or "could not duplicate", AND the bill for the repair of the brakes) that would be best. The more incriminating evidence you have, the better. Ford doesn't like to be any form of sympathetic unless you have evidence in writing.
